Atmel SAM | Adapting to a CMake build system

Dependencies

When developing for an Atmel SAM board (i.e. SparkFun SAMD51 ThingPlus, Adafruit Feather M0 Express), the base requirements include:

Between these two dependencies, a program will need to know:
  • Include directory of CMSIS
  • Include directory of DFP
  • Linker Script location